Republicans Condemn Attacks Against CBP Officers

Republicans are outraged by recent assaults against Customs and Border Patrol (CBP) agents in McAllen, Texas.

The attack has occurred as tensions surge in response to President Donald Trump’s strict enforcement of immigration laws.

According to the Department of Homeland Security (DHS), a lone shooter attacked a CBP office in an attempted ambush of CBP and law enforcement officers.

Two police officers and a Border Patrol employee were reportedly injured by the shooter, who was neutralized shortly after initiating the attack.

CBP warned “there will be legal consequences for those who incite violence against CBP agents and officers.”

Republican officials have generally condemned the attack and blamed Democrats for promoting opposition to CBP officials and other law enforcement agents.

“When Democrats assault our brave law enforcement officers with their actions and rhetoric it encourages unstable people to go even further,” stated House Speaker Mike Johnson (R-FL).

Last month, Democrat Congresswoman LaMonica McIver was charged with “forcibly impeding and interfering” with law enforcement after she physically assaulted immigration officers.

Congresswoman McIver had formed part of a group of Democrat lawmakers who attempted to visit an immigration detention center but were prevented from doing so by ICE agents, at which point the lawmakers pushed past the agents to force their way into the building.

Body cam footage reveals McIver pushing ICE personnel to clear a path forward.

“Attacks on our brave law enforcement officers and agents must end,” said Senator Rick Scott (R-FL).

Besides McAllen’s Representative Vicente Gonzalez (D-TX), scant Democrats have condemned the latest attacks against CBP.

Consequently, Republicans are demanding for Democrats to begin publicly supporting immigration law enforcement officials.

“We call on every elected official to insist that law enforcement MUST be treated with the dignity and respect they deserve,” requested Speaker Johnson.
